OUR TASK
The project concerns the restoration of the original entrance to the National Archaeological Museum of Venice from Piazza San Marco, the inner courtyard designed by Vincenzo Scamozzi, and the bookshop. The museum is housed on the first floor of the Procuratie Nuove palace, built in the early 17th century bordering Piazza San Marco to the south.

THE CONTEXT
The Museo Archeologico Nazionale in Venice is an archaeological museum on St Mark’s Square, which holds a notable collection of antiquities, mainly Greek and Roman sculptures. Before the works, the Archaeological Museum entrance was from the Correr Museum. Experimentally, on the occasion of the exhibition by the artist Mark Quinn, hosted in the rooms of the archaeological museum, the original access from Piazza San Marco has been reactivated.

The project
The restoration work involved the demolition of the wood entrance compass and the restoration of the vestibule and courtyard. The entrance compass demolition allowed the maximum visual permeability of the courtyard and the colonnade of the internal façade that houses the statue of Agrippa Grimani. Finally, the project involves the transformation of a warehouse on the ground floor into a bookshop and ticket office.
